site stats

Bitslice aes

http://koclab.cs.ucsb.edu/teaching/cren/project/2008/venugopal+gupta.pdf WebJul 8, 2013 · I am interested to do AES bulk encryption on GPU for HPC applications using Bit-slice approach as of my project. In this regards, i have found many papers, …

SM4算法的Bitslice实现 · GitHub

WebFeb 19, 2024 · The advent of CUDA-enabled GPU makes it possible to provide cloud applications with high-performance data security services. Unfortunately, recent studies have shown that GPU-based applications are also susceptible to side-channel attacks. These published work studied the side-channel vulnerabilities of GPU-based AES … WebThis demonstrate a masked, bit sliced implementation of AES-128. masked: It use boolean masking to thwart DPA, template attacks and other side channel attacks. bit sliced: It … how do i get to the menu https://frenchtouchupholstery.com

How do Käsper and Schwabe

WebPreparing Tomorrow’s Cryptography: Parallel Computation via Multiple Processors, Vector Processing, and Multi-Cored Chips Eric C. Seidel, advisor Joseph N. Gregg PhD WebThis demonstrate a masked, bit sliced implementation of AES-128. masked: It use boolean masking to thwart DPA, template attacks and other side channel attacks. bit sliced: It computes much like a hardware implementation. Depending on CPU register size, it can compute several operations simultaneously. WebNote that, even though standard non-bitsliced AES only processes one block of data at a time, I've included a block number at the top row of the diagram. This becomes relevant when comparing this standard packing order with the internal order used by Käsper and Schwabe, since their bitsliced AES implementation processes 8 blocks at the same time. how do i get to the pitcairn islands

praca licencjacka 22 …

Category:How is bitslicing faster? - Cryptography Stack Exchange

Tags:Bitslice aes

Bitslice aes

Which is slower, AES or GCM hash (GHASH), if CPU has no special ...

Web6 FixslicingAES-likeCiphers considerthisoptimizationforourbenchmarkssincethereisnopracticalresultsavailable. …

Bitslice aes

Did you know?

WebAES is a symmetric key algorithm and offers higher security compared to DES. The simplicity of its design results in efficient implementations on soft-ware platforms. In this … Web开馆时间:周一至周日7:00-22:30 周五 7:00-12:00; 我的图书馆

WebAug 14, 2015 · 22. I recentely faced the issue of random access decryption while AES-GCM was being used. I said this person that the underlying CTR should allow parallelization but I have no idea how authentication comes into play. Now I know that one of the cool features of CTR is that you can decrypt any block without needing to involve any other blocks. WebFeb 19, 2024 · The advent of CUDA-enabled GPU makes it possible to provide cloud applications with high-performance data security services. Unfortunately, recent studies …

WebMay 18, 2024 · The complete RSFQ S-box circuit costs a total of 42237 Josephson junctions with nearly 130 Gbps throughput under the maximum simulated frequency of 16.28 GHz. … Webbit-slice: [adjective] composed of a number of smaller processors that each handle a portion of a task concurrently.

WebKatedra podstaw informatyki i systemów informatycznych Tomasz Grabowski „Szyfrowanie danych”

WebNov 4, 2009 · This work explores ways to reduce the number of bit operations required to implement AES, including optimizing the composite field approach for entire rounds of AES and integrating the Galois multiplications of MixColumns with the linear transformations of the S-box. We explore ways to reduce the number of bit operations required to … how do i get to the nearest bank in spanishWebIt is rapidly becoming popular due to its good security features, efficiency, performance and simplicity. In this paper we present an implementation of AES using the bitslice … Bitslice Implementation of AES. Chester Rebeiro, David Selvakumar, A. S. L. … how do i get to the paladin class hallWebJan 10, 2024 · Bitslice implementation of . AES. In International Conference on Cryptology and Network Security (pp. 203-212). Springer, Berlin, Heidelberg. [23] Dinu ... how much is troy ounceWebNotably, though, (binary) Galois field multiplication is a lot easier to bitslice than ordinary multiplication, due to the absence of carries. Also, multiplication (whether ordinary or in a … how do i get to the national arboretumWebAug 15, 2024 · In a bitslice representation though, permuting bits really just means using the “right” variables in the next step; this is mere data routing, which is resolved at compile-time, with no cost at runtime. ... This AES … how do i get to the motherlode dungeonWebMay 13, 2024 · AES-128 is considered by experts to have a security level of 128 bits. Similarly, AES-192 gets certified at 192-bit security, and AES-256 gets 256-bit security. However, the AES block size is only 128 bits! That might not sound like a big deal, but it severely limits the constructions you can create out of AES. how do i get to the outlandsWebWe demonstrate and analyze multiple versions of AES from a side-channel analysis and a fault-injection perspective, in addition to providing a detailed performance evaluation of the protected designs. • The instruction fault sensitivity of parallel bitslices in an instruction is matched. ... We obtain the bitslice representation through a ... how much is troy aikman worth